Question 1

During forging of a solid cylinder, the final diameter comes out to be 2 times the initial, the percentage change in height will be _________.

Question 2

In open die forging, a disc of diameter 400 mm and height 100 mm is compressed without any barreling effect. The final diameter of disc 800 mm. The true strain is _________.

Question 3

10 mm diameter holes are to be punched in a steel sheet of 3 mm thickness. Shear strength of the material is 400 N/mm2 and penetration is 40%. Shear provided on the punch is 2 mm. The blanking force during the operation will be

Question 4

A rectangular hole of size 100 mm × 50 mm is to be made on a 5 mm thick sheet of steel having ultimate tensile strength and shear strength of 500 MPa and 300 MPa, respectively. The hole is made by punching process. Neglecting the effect of clearance, the punching force (in kN) is

Question 5

By application of tensile force, the cross-sectional area of bar ‘P’ is first reduced by 30% and then by additional 25%. Another bar ‘Q’ of the same material is reduced in cross-sectional area by 50% in single step by applying tensile force. After deformation, the ratio of true strain in bar ‘P’ to bar ‘Q’ will be _____.

Question 6

A round disk of 150 mm diameter is to be blanked from a strip of 3.2mm, half-hard cold rolled steel whose shear strength = 310 MPa.(for half hard cold rolled steel, clearance= 0.075 x thickness).Calculate the blanking force.
